Abstract(in English) As the number of the smartphone users rapidly increases, various problems about using smartphones have been recognized. It is important to identify in what areas and to what extent accessing to the internet and other services through smartphones has effects on communication patterns and users’ life, to analyze the causes of recognized problems, and to build up better strategies of using mobile devises. In order to address these problems, the Precede-Proceed Model(PP Model or MIDORI Model), which was originally built to provide health promotion planning and evaluation, was employed in the field of communication through mobile devises. A preliminary survey concerning the effects of using smartphones on female university students’ life was conducted, which corresponded to the needs assessment phase of the PP Model. After reporting the results of the survey, the factors concerning the assessments of social factors and epidemiological factors were extracted.
